The Fundamentals of Epoxy Injection Molding



Epoxy injection molding is a remarkable procedure that incorporates accuracy and convenience to develop long lasting components. You start by blending epoxy material with a hardener, which launches a chemical reaction, leading to a solid material. The mixture's viscosity enables it to flow conveniently into molds, recording complex information and complicated shapes.Once the epoxy is injected into the mold and mildew, it remedies under regulated temperature level and pressure, guaranteeing a solid bond and exceptional structural integrity. You can adjust the formulation, enabling boosted properties such as boosted resistance to chemicals or enhanced thermal stability.This process is particularly beneficial for creating intricate components made use of in various sectors, including automotive, aerospace, and electronics. By leveraging epoxy shot molding, you have the ability to achieve high-quality, light-weight components that satisfy stringent efficiency needs. On the whole, comprehending the essentials of this molding technique sets the structure for valuing its more comprehensive applications and benefits.

What Is the Normal Lead Time for Epoxy Injection Molded Components?



Generally, you can anticipate a preparation of 4 to 6 weeks for epoxy shot formed parts. Elements like design production, intricacy, and tooling volume can affect this duration, so strategy accordingly.


Exist Specific Safety Actions for Handling Epoxy Products?



Yes, there specify precaution for handling epoxy materials. You need to use gloves, goggles, and a mask to avoid skin get in touch with and inhalation.
